< prev index next >

modules/web/src/ios/java/javafx/scene/web/WebEngine.java

Print this page




 167     // Settings
 168 
 169     /**
 170      * Specifies whether JavaScript execution is enabled.
 171      *
 172      * @defaultValue true
 173      * @since JavaFX 2.2
 174      */
 175     private BooleanProperty javaScriptEnabled;
 176 
 177     public final void setJavaScriptEnabled(boolean value) {
 178         javaScriptEnabledProperty().set(value);
 179     }
 180 
 181     public final boolean isJavaScriptEnabled() {
 182         return javaScriptEnabled == null ? true : javaScriptEnabled.get();
 183     }
 184 
 185     private Debugger debugger = new DebuggerImpl();
 186 
 187     @Deprecated
 188     public Debugger impl_getDebugger(){
 189         return debugger;
 190     }
 191 
 192     public final BooleanProperty javaScriptEnabledProperty() {
 193         if (javaScriptEnabled == null) {
 194             javaScriptEnabled = new BooleanPropertyBase(true) {
 195                 @Override public void invalidated() {
 196                     checkThread();
 197                 }
 198 
 199                 @Override public Object getBean() {
 200                     return WebEngine.this;
 201                 }
 202 
 203                 @Override public String getName() {
 204                     return "javaScriptEnabled";
 205                 }
 206             };
 207         }
 208         return javaScriptEnabled;




 167     // Settings
 168 
 169     /**
 170      * Specifies whether JavaScript execution is enabled.
 171      *
 172      * @defaultValue true
 173      * @since JavaFX 2.2
 174      */
 175     private BooleanProperty javaScriptEnabled;
 176 
 177     public final void setJavaScriptEnabled(boolean value) {
 178         javaScriptEnabledProperty().set(value);
 179     }
 180 
 181     public final boolean isJavaScriptEnabled() {
 182         return javaScriptEnabled == null ? true : javaScriptEnabled.get();
 183     }
 184 
 185     private Debugger debugger = new DebuggerImpl();
 186 
 187     Debugger getDebugger(){

 188         return debugger;
 189     }
 190 
 191     public final BooleanProperty javaScriptEnabledProperty() {
 192         if (javaScriptEnabled == null) {
 193             javaScriptEnabled = new BooleanPropertyBase(true) {
 194                 @Override public void invalidated() {
 195                     checkThread();
 196                 }
 197 
 198                 @Override public Object getBean() {
 199                     return WebEngine.this;
 200                 }
 201 
 202                 @Override public String getName() {
 203                     return "javaScriptEnabled";
 204                 }
 205             };
 206         }
 207         return javaScriptEnabled;


< prev index next >